Expo Phase 2 Update Meeting Tonight in Santa Monica

Expo Phase 2
An Expo Line Phase 2 Update meeting will be held in Santa Monica tonight. Another similar meeting will be held in Los Angeles next week. (Image courtesy of Metro)

The Exposition Construction Authority, which is overseeing the Expo Line’s Phase 2 construction in West Los Angeles and Santa Monica, will be hosting a construction update community meeting tonight at the Crossroads School’s Community Room.

Santa Monica stakeholders will be given information of upcoming construction activities and timelines for Expo Phase 2.

A formal presentation will be made at 6:30 p.m.

At 7 p.m., an open house session will be held to facilitate community input and dialog.

Tonight’s meeting is geared specifically toward Santa Monica stakeholders.

An Expo Phase 2 construction update for Los Angeles stakeholders will be held April 29 with the same agenda: formal presentations at 6:30 p.m. and an open discussion at 7 p.m. The Los Angeles update meeting will be held at the gymnasium of Vista Del Mar Child and Family Services, 3200 Motor Avenue. (Parking available on campus).

Crossroads School is located at 1715 Olympic Boulevard in Santa Monica, near the intersection of Olympic and 17th Street. The entrance is off 18th Street; parking is available on campus and surrounding streets.

For more information about Expo Phase 2 and the entire light rail project, which will connect the Pier and Third Street Promenade in Santa Monica to Downtown Los Angeles and select points due east by 2016, please visit BuiltExpo.org or call (213) 922-EXPO (3976).

The first phase of the Expo Line, which is already running, ends at Culver Boulevard and Jefferson in Culver City. Expo Line’s second phase would add seven new stations between Downtown Culver City and Downtown Santa Monica, including one in Palms, another in Westwood, two in West Los Angeles, and then three in Santa Monica.
